Aaron Boone Says Anthony Volpe Will Remain in Minors Through Weekend

Some reports surfaced earlier this week that the New York Yankees would return the services of Anthony Volpe for his 2026 season debut either Wednesday or Thursday this week. It’s now Friday, Volpe is not back with the club, and manager Aaron Boone recently said Volpe will remain in the minors through the weekend.

New York has to make a decision with Volpe soon.

Brendan Kuty wrote (on May 1): “Boone says Volpe will play in Somerset through the weekend”

Chris Kirschner followed that up with the fact that the Yankees will have to make a decision on Volpe soon:

“Volpe’s 20-day clock for his rehab assignment expires on Sunday. He will either have to be activated on Monday or be optioned.”

Anthony Volpe has become quite the controversial infielder in New York, and with the Yankees performing so well lately, some are beginning to question what his role with the team actually will be. He’s taken 34 at-bats in the minors and appears to be fully healthy after offseason shoulder surgery. Volpe tore his labrum at some point last season.

When Will Anthony Volpe Return?

It’s the biggest question surrounding the New York Yankees right now. The calendar has now turned to May, and Volpe still isn’t with the big league club.

And Aaron Boone has been asked plenty of times about him, but he pretty much sidesteps the question every time. Volpe hit .212 last season with 19 HR, 72 RBI, and 150 strikeouts. Jose Caballero has been hitting well at the shortstop position in Volpe’s absence.

This Volpe-Yankees situation also brings up the idea of the Yankees just trading Anthony Volpe while they still can, and offloading this drama completely.

Either way, a final decision will be made here by the end of the weekend, and it’s very plausible that Boone reveals after the Orioles game on Friday that Volpe will rejoin the team on Saturday.
